# Gossamer Environments: Translation-String Extraction Script

Quick heads-up for reviewers: the extraction script (`pullstrings`) behaves differently per environment. In dev it scans everything; in staging and prod it only touches tagged modules, otherwise we'd flood the translators with test fixtures. If a PR changes extraction behavior, check it against the prod settings, not your local ones. The production configuration it reads at runtime is as follows.

service settings:
PRAWYN_PIN=9848
PRAWYN_METRICS_HOST=metrics.prawyn.lumicworks.corp
PRAWYN_LOG_LEVEL=warn
PRAWYN_TENANT=pelius

FAQ — Proctoring queue basics (Quizzleton contractors)

Q: My exam session is stuck in the Hallpass proctoring queue — what now?

A: The queue drains every 90 seconds; if a session sits longer than five minutes, it's probably a stale lease. Don't requeue manually — that duplicates sessions. Instead, open the contractor recovery tool and release the lease. The tool will ask for the recovery passphrase below.

unlock words, yadup-yagef: zorael-druix

Ticket: Drift in bulk-edit settings — Opsgrid admin table

Bulk edits in the Opsgrid admin table behave differently across environments: staging allows 500-row batches, prod silently caps at 50. Someone changed prod limits outside the repo. This caused last week's pricing update to half-apply. Flagging for the eng sync: we need ownership of these knobs and a reconcile job. Expected baseline values are as follows:

deployment values, kajep-kageg:
[praix]
host = praix.paliqcorp.corp
user = praix_svc
database = praix_prod

Action item: The Relayn deploy-status bot silently dropped updates when the pipeline API paginated results, so responders believed a rollback had completed when it had not. We will add pagination handling, a staleness banner, and an integration test. Until merged, verify deploy state directly in the pipeline console, documented at the page below.

runbook for kahop-kajop: https://rundeck.ordinio.test/display/secrets/pipeline/issue/pages/repo/browse/e5732776e07d1285107e5aeb